An industrial building is not defined by structure alone. Use, process, services, fire safety, power and future expansion must be coordinated from the outset.
Typical requirements
- Define structure and geometry around intended use.
- Size electricity, ventilation and fire safety.
- Prepare activity, services and commissioning documentation.

Can the activity be assessed before design is settled?
Yes. Introducing process, loads and services early reduces changes between architecture, structure and activity.
